当前位置 : 祺云SEO > 云计算>

如何判断CDN效果好不好?CDN加速效果差怎么办

时间:2026-06-26 来源:祺云SEO
CDN常见10个问题及解决方法
百纵科技
4581231原视频地址

核心指标:从用户感知到技术数据的双重验证

评估CDN效果,首先要区分“感觉快”和“真的快”,用户的主观体验往往受网络环境波动影响,因此必须结合客观技术指标,业内专家指出,首屏加载时间(FCP)和可交互时间(TTI)是衡量用户体验最直观的两个维度。

首屏加载时间与资源加载成功率

首屏加载时间是指用户打开页面到主要内容完全展示的时间,对于电商或资讯类网站,这一指标直接关联转化率,如果CDN生效,静态资源(如图片、CSS、JS)应从最近的边缘节点获取,而非远端的源站。

在实操中,你可以使用Chrome浏览器的开发者工具(F12)查看“Network”面板,重点关注以下数据:

  • 状态码分布:理想的CDN响应中,200OK应占据绝大多数,且大部分请求的服务器IP应属于CDN厂商的IP段,而非你的源站IP。
  • 加载耗时:静态资源的加载时间通常应在几十毫秒级别,如果某个静态资源加载超过500毫秒,说明该资源可能回源失败或节点距离过远。
  • 资源命中率:这是衡量CDN效率的关键,高命中率意味着大部分请求在边缘节点直接返回,无需回源,若命中率低于80%,说明CDN缓存策略可能存在问题,导致源站压力过大。

源站负载与带宽成本对比

CDN的另一个核心价值是减轻源站压力,通过对比开启CDN前后的源站带宽峰值和CPU使用率,可以直观看到加速效果。

  • 带宽节省:多数情况下,CDN能拦截80%以上的静态流量,如果开启后源站带宽并未明显下降,需检查是否配置了动态加速或HTTPS证书错误导致频繁回源。
  • 并发处理能力:在流量高峰期间,观察源站是否出现宕机或响应超时,若源站负载平稳,说明CDN有效分担了并发请求。

场景化测试:不同地域与网络环境下的表现差异

CDN的效果并非全局一致,它高度依赖于用户所在地与CDN节点之间的距离,单一地点的测试数据往往具有误导性。

多地域节点覆盖测试

中国地域辽阔,南北电信、联通、移动网络差异巨大,要全面评估CDN效果,必须进行多地域、多运营商的对比测试。

可以使用在线测速工具或自建监控探针,模拟来自北京(电信)、上海(联通)、广州(移动)以及偏远地区(如新疆、西藏)的用户访问,重点关注:

  • 延迟(Latency):不同地域的PING值差异,若某地域延迟超过200毫秒,说明该区域节点覆盖不足或路由优化不佳。
  • 丢包率:高丢包率会导致页面加载卡顿,若特定运营商丢包率高,可能需要联系CDN厂商调整路由策略。

移动端与弱网环境适应性

随着移动互联网占比提升,移动端体验至关重要,在3G/4G甚至弱网环境下,CDN的压缩技术和协议优化(如HTTP/2、QUIC)显得尤为重要。

  • Gzip/Brotli压缩:检查响应头中是否包含正确的压缩标识,若未开启压缩,文本类资源体积可能增大3-5倍,严重拖慢加载速度。
  • TCP连接复用:在移动端,频繁建立TCP连接会消耗大量时间,CDN应支持连接复用,减少握手次数。

常见问题排查:为何CDN效果不如预期?

有时,CDN效果不佳并非厂商问题,而是配置或使用方式不当,以下是几种常见场景及解决方案。

缓存策略配置错误

如果静态资源频繁回源,可能是缓存过期时间(TTL)设置过短,建议将图片、CSS、JS等静态资源的缓存时间设置为7天以上,对于动态内容,可设置较短的缓存时间或使用边缘计算逻辑。

HTTPS证书配置问题

若网站启用HTTPS,确保证书正确安装且支持SNI(服务器名称指示),证书错误会导致浏览器拒绝连接或强制回源,严重影响安全性与速度。

加速不足

CDN对静态资源加速效果显著,但对动态API请求加速有限,若网站大量依赖实时数据交互,应考虑使用CDN提供的动态加速服务或专线接入,而非仅依赖普通边缘节点。

价格与性价比:如何选择合适的CDN方案?

在评估效果的同时,成本控制不可忽视,不同CDN厂商的定价策略差异较大,需根据业务需求选择。

流量计费vs带宽峰值计费

  • 流量计费:适合流量波动大、峰值不高的场景,按实际流出流量付费,无闲置成本。
  • 带宽峰值计费:适合流量稳定、峰值可预测的场景,若峰值带宽较低,此方式可能更经济。

免费套餐与付费服务的对比

许多厂商提供免费套餐,但节点数量有限,服务质量无SLA保障,对于核心业务,建议付费购买专业版,享受更多节点覆盖、优先客服支持及高级安全功能,据工信部数据,近年来云服务市场竞争激烈,主流厂商均提供灵活的计费模式,用户可根据实际用量灵活切换。

Q&A:关于CDN效果评估的常见疑问

如何判断CDN效果是否达标?

判断CDN效果需综合多项指标:首屏加载时间缩短至1秒内,静态资源命中率超过90%,源站带宽压力降低50%以上,且多地域测试延迟稳定在200毫秒以内,若满足这些条件,即可认为CDN效果良好。

CDN开启后网站变慢怎么办?

若开启CDN后速度反而变慢,首先检查DNS解析是否正确指向CDNCNAME,查看源站日志,确认是否有大量403或502错误回源,检查缓存策略是否导致动态内容被错误缓存,或静态资源未开启压缩。

CDN对SEO有什么影响?

CDN通过提升加载速度和稳定性,间接提升SEO排名,搜索引擎将页面加载速度作为rankingfactor,更快的响应时间有助于降低跳出率,增加页面收录概率,但需确保CDN节点IP不被搜索引擎屏蔽,且Content-Length等响应头正确传递。